What is the cheapest month to fly from Omaha to Ho Chi Minh City?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Omaha to Ho Chi Minh City,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Omaha to Ho Chi Minh City is March, where tickets cost $1,024 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are July and June,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$1,611 and $1,346 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Omaha to Ho Chi Minh City?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Omaha to Ho Chi Minh City,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Omaha to Ho Chi Minh City, you should book around 1 week before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 25 weeks before departure.

  • Which airline alliances offer flights from Omaha to Ho Chi Minh City?

    SkyTeam, oneworld, and Star Alliance are the airline alliances operating flights between Omaha and Ho Chi Minh City, with SkyTeam being the most commonly used for this route.

  • Which is the best airline for flights from Omaha to Ho Chi Minh City, EVA Air or ANA?

    The two airlines most popular with KAYAK users for flights from Omaha to Ho Chi Minh City are EVA Air and ANA. With an average price for the route of $1,286 and an overall rating of 8.5, EVA Air is the most popular choice. ANA is also a great choice for the route, with an average price of $1,609 and an overall rating of 8.3.
